Why Free SSL and Unlimited Bandwidth Matter

Before diving into the “who’s who” of hosting, let’s pause and ask: why should you even care about SSL and unlimited bandwidth?

1. Free SSL – Because Security Is Non-Negotiable

Have you ever seen that little padlock icon in your browser’s address bar? That’s SSL at work. SSL certificates encrypt the data sent between your website and your visitors, keeping sensitive information—like passwords and payment details—safe.

Without SSL, your website isn’t just vulnerable; Google may even flag it as “Not Secure.” Free SSL certificates included in hosting plans mean you don’t have to pay extra or struggle with manual installation. It’s peace of mind bundled with your hosting.

2. Unlimited Bandwidth – No More Worrying About Traffic Surges

Bandwidth is essentially how much data your website can send to visitors. If your plan limits bandwidth, a sudden traffic spike—maybe from a viral post or seasonal sale—can crash your site or trigger extra fees.

Unlimited bandwidth ensures your website can handle growth without breaking the bank or frustrating visitors. For bloggers, online stores, or businesses, this is an absolute lifesaver.

⚡ How to Choose the Best Hosting Plan for You

Even with these great options, the “best” plan depends on your needs. Here are a few questions to guide you:

  1. How much traffic do you expect? If you anticipate growth, unlimited bandwidth is non-negotiable.

  2. Do you need WordPress-specific hosting? Some providers optimize servers specifically for WordPress.

  3. What’s your budget? Consider renewal costs, not just introductory pricing.

  4. How important is support? If you’re new to websites, 24/7 responsive support is priceless.

  5. Do you plan to scale? VPS or cloud hosting options might be worth considering for growing sites.


Bonus Features to Look For

  • Automatic backups: Accidents happen. Make sure your host has regular backups.

  • Free website migration: Switching hosts shouldn’t feel like a headache.

  • CDN integration: Faster loading for visitors around the world.

  • Security tools: Malware scanning, firewalls, and DDoS protection.


Common Mistakes to Avoid

Even with the best plans, people sometimes make errors that cost time or money:

  • Focusing only on price: Cheap isn’t always cheerful if it means slow speed or poor support.

  • Ignoring renewal fees: Introductory pricing is often much lower than renewals.

  • Neglecting support quality: When your website goes down, good support is priceless.

  • Skipping SSL check: Even “free” SSL may need manual activation if the host doesn’t automate it.
